Description
Rubric creation helps clarify learning goals for instructors and creates a transparent and clear grading scheme for students. Using rubrics for grading makes grading more consistent and faster. In this session, we will draw on the research literature to explore the benefits to both students and instructors of creating and using grading rubrics and gain some practice in creating and evaluating rubrics. 

After this workshop participants will be able to: 

  • Define what a rubric is, different types of rubrics, and the components of rubrics.
  • Describe benefits of using rubrics for students, instructors, and graders.
  • Identify qualities of effective and ineffective rubrics.
  • Apply rubric design principles to specific courses/assignments.
